Eurizon Capital SGR S.p.A. purchased a new position in shares of U.S. Bancorp (NYSE:USB – Free Report) in the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und purchased 1,097,345 shares of the financial services provider’s stock, valued at approximately $58,576,000. Eurizon Capital SGR S.p.A. owned about 0.07% of U.S. Bancorp as of its most recent SEC filing.

U.S. Bancorp Stock Up 0.8%
USB opened at $54.87 on Friday.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.03, a current ratio of 0.81 and a quick ratio of 0.81. The stock has a market capitalization of $85.17 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 11.50,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 0.98 and a beta of 1.00. The business has a 50-day moving average of $54.42 and a two-hundred day moving average of $53.92. U.S. Bancorp has a 12 month low of $42.55 and a 12 month high of $61.19.
U.S. Bancorp Dividend Announcement
The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, April 15th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, March 31st were issued a dividend of $0.52 per share. The ex-dividend date was Tuesday, March 31st. This represents a $2.08 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 3.8%. U.S. Bancorp’s payout ratio is presently 43.61%.

U.S. Bancorp Profile
U.S. Bancorp (NYSE: USB) is a bank holding company and the parent of U.S. Bank, a national commercial bank that provides a wide range of banking, investment, mortgage, trust and payment services. The company operates through consumer and business banking, commercial banking, payment services, and wealth management segments. Its product set includes deposit accounts, consumer and commercial lending, mortgage origination and servicing, credit and debit card services, treasury and cash management, merchant processing, and institutional and trust services.
